Decision details mechanism and controls

KUWAIT CITY, Jan 5: The Minister of Social Affairs, Minister of Awqaf and Islamic Affairs Issa Al- Kandari has issued a ministerial decision detailing the mechanism and controls that must be adopted concerning accounts of societies and the cooperative societies union.

The first article of the decision, a copy of which has been obtained by the Al-Seyassah daily, states that the violations attributed to cooperative societies are investigated by a committee formed for this purpose based on a complaint submitted to the Ministry or a report submitted by one of the departments of the Cooperation Affairs Sector, and that the committee is formed by a decision of the assistant undersecretary of the ministry for cooperative societies affairs after the approval of the undersecretary based on a memorandum submitted to him that includes the reasons and justifications for the formation of the committee.

In the statement it must be mentioned whether the financial or administrative controller of the society or both took any measures regarding suspicions related to mismanagement or behavior by the board of directors of the association or any of those in charge of managing the association or its employees.

In the first article, the decision also stipulates that the committee undertakes to investigate and checks the work and accounts of the concerned institution, provided members of the committee legal experts, accountants and the committee must have at least five but not more than n seven, including the president.

The second article defines the procedures of the investigation committee so that it prepares the minutes of the meeting to start the work of the committee, determines the tasks and specializations of each member, and searches and investigates the complaint or the report on the violations attributed to the association in coordination with the administration, the concerned authorities and the cooperative societies observers by examining and reviewing the general budget of the association and all financial and all administrative documents, books and accounting records related to the activity of the association, as well as ensuring the integrity, suitability and the recognized accounting systems.

The same article also stipulates that the committee refers the initial report to the assistant undersecretary of the cooperatives sector for his review and invite members of the board of directors of the association for a meeting during which they are informed of the report and listen to their comments and give them time to study the report provided the time frame does not exceed three months.

The third article states, “Within a week of the end of its work, the head of the committee shall hand over to the assistant undersecretary for cooperative affairs sector the original report to take appropriate action. The fifth article specifies the period of work of the investigation committee as 60 days, and it may be extended for a similar period. The Undersecretary of the ministry may also extend the work of the committee for another similar period to complete its work.
